Psalm 11(GNT)

God’s Renewing Word of Prayer Introduction Psalm 11: In this short psalm, an individual who has found safety in the LORD is addressing another individual and affirming trust and confidence in the LORD. Luke 11:1-13(GNT)

God’s Renewing Word of Prayer Introduction Luke 11:1-13: In response to a request from one of the disciples, Jesus teaches his followers to pray. He reveals the fatherhood of God to his disciples and the limitless capacity of God’s love, faithfulness, generosity, compassion, and care.
